+class DefaultRebalanceCb : public RdKafka::RebalanceCb {
+ private:
+ static string part_list_print(
+ const vector<RdKafka::TopicPartition *> &partitions) {
+ ostringstream ss;
+ for (unsigned int i = 0; i < partitions.size(); i++)
+ ss << (i == 0 ? "" : ", ") << partitions[i]->topic() << " ["
+ << partitions[i]->partition() << "]";
+ return ss.str();
+ }
+
+ public:
+ int assign_call_cnt;
+ int revoke_call_cnt;
+ int nonempty_assign_call_cnt; /**< ASSIGN_PARTITIONS with partitions */
+ int lost_call_cnt;
+ int partitions_assigned_net;
+ bool wait_rebalance;
+ int64_t ts_last_assign; /**< Timestamp of last rebalance assignment */
+ map<Toppar, int> msg_cnt; /**< Number of consumed messages per partition. */
+
+ ~DefaultRebalanceCb() {
+ reset_msg_cnt();
+ }
+
+ DefaultRebalanceCb() :
+ assign_call_cnt(0),
+ revoke_call_cnt(0),
+ nonempty_assign_call_cnt(0),
+ lost_call_cnt(0),
+ partitions_assigned_net(0),
+ wait_rebalance(false),
+ ts_last_assign(0) {
+ }
+
+
+ void rebalance_cb(RdKafka::KafkaConsumer *consumer,
+ RdKafka::ErrorCode err,
+ std::vector<RdKafka::TopicPartition *> &partitions) {
+ wait_rebalance = false;
+
+ std::string protocol = consumer->rebalance_protocol();
+
+ TEST_ASSERT(protocol == "COOPERATIVE",
+ "%s: Expected rebalance_protocol \"COOPERATIVE\", not %s",
+ consumer->name().c_str(), protocol.c_str());
+
+ const char *lost_str = consumer->assignment_lost() ? " (LOST)" : "";
+ Test::Say(tostr() << _C_YEL "RebalanceCb " << protocol << ": "
+ << consumer->name() << " " << RdKafka::err2str(err)
+ << lost_str << ": " << part_list_print(partitions)
+ << "\n");
+
+ if (err == RdKafka::ERR__ASSIGN_PARTITIONS) {
+ if (consumer->assignment_lost())
+ Test::Fail("unexpected lost assignment during ASSIGN rebalance");
+ RdKafka::Error *error = consumer->incremental_assign(partitions);
+ if (error)
+ Test::Fail(tostr() << "consumer->incremental_assign() failed: "
+ << error->str());
+ if (partitions.size() > 0)
+ nonempty_assign_call_cnt++;
+ assign_call_cnt += 1;
+ partitions_assigned_net += (int)partitions.size();
+ ts_last_assign = test_clock();
+
+ } else {
+ if (consumer->assignment_lost())
+ lost_call_cnt += 1;
+ RdKafka::Error *error = consumer->incremental_unassign(partitions);
+ if (error)
+ Test::Fail(tostr() << "consumer->incremental_unassign() failed: "
+ << error->str());
+ if (partitions.size() == 0)
+ Test::Fail("revoked partitions size should never be 0");
+ revoke_call_cnt += 1;
+ partitions_assigned_net -= (int)partitions.size();
+ }
+
+ /* Reset message counters for the given partitions. */
+ Test::Say(consumer->name() + ": resetting message counters:\n");
+ reset_msg_cnt(partitions);
+ }
+
+ bool poll_once(RdKafka::KafkaConsumer *c, int timeout_ms) {
+ RdKafka::Message *msg = c->consume(timeout_ms);
+ bool ret = msg->err() != RdKafka::ERR__TIMED_OUT;
+ if (!msg->err())
+ msg_cnt[Toppar(msg->topic_name(), msg->partition())]++;
+ delete msg;
+ return ret;
+ }
+
+ void reset_msg_cnt() {
+ msg_cnt.clear();
+ }
+
+ void reset_msg_cnt(Toppar &tp) {
+ int msgcnt = get_msg_cnt(tp);
+ Test::Say(tostr() << " RESET " << tp.topic << " [" << tp.partition << "]"
+ << " with " << msgcnt << " messages\n");
+ if (!msg_cnt.erase(tp) && msgcnt)
+ Test::Fail("erase failed!");
+ }
+
+ void reset_msg_cnt(const vector<RdKafka::TopicPartition *> &partitions) {
+ for (unsigned int i = 0; i < partitions.size(); i++) {
+ Toppar tp(partitions[i]->topic(), partitions[i]->partition());
+ reset_msg_cnt(tp);
+ }
+ }
+
+ int get_msg_cnt(const Toppar &tp) {
+ map<Toppar, int>::iterator it = msg_cnt.find(tp);
+ if (it == msg_cnt.end())
+ return 0;
+ return it->second;
+ }
+};

+/* Check behavior when:
+ * 1. single topic with 2 partitions.
+ * 2. consumer 1 (with rebalance_cb) subscribes to it.
+ * 3. consumer 2 (with rebalance_cb) subscribes to it.
+ * 4. close.
+ */
+
+static void b_subscribe_with_cb_test(rd_bool_t close_consumer) {
+ SUB_TEST();
+
+ std::string topic_name = Test::mk_topic_name("0113-cooperative_rebalance", 1);
+ std::string group_name =
+ Test::mk_unique_group_name("0113-cooperative_rebalance");
+ test_create_topic(NULL, topic_name.c_str(), 2, 1);
+
+ DefaultRebalanceCb rebalance_cb1;
+ RdKafka::KafkaConsumer *c1 = make_consumer(
+ "C_1", group_name, "cooperative-sticky", NULL, &rebalance_cb1, 25);
+ DefaultRebalanceCb rebalance_cb2;
+ RdKafka::KafkaConsumer *c2 = make_consumer(
+ "C_2", group_name, "cooperative-sticky", NULL, &rebalance_cb2, 25);
+ test_wait_topic_exists(c1->c_ptr(), topic_name.c_str(), 10 * 1000);
+
+ Test::subscribe(c1, topic_name);
+
+ bool c2_subscribed = false;
+ while (true) {
+ Test::poll_once(c1, 500);
+ Test::poll_once(c2, 500);
+
+ /* Start c2 after c1 has received initial assignment */
+ if (!c2_subscribed && rebalance_cb1.assign_call_cnt > 0) {
+ Test::subscribe(c2, topic_name);
+ c2_subscribed = true;
+ }
+
+ /* Failure case: test will time out. */
+ if (rebalance_cb1.assign_call_cnt == 3 &&
+ rebalance_cb2.assign_call_cnt == 2) {
+ break;
+ }
+ }
+
+ /* Sequence of events:
+ *
+ * 1. c1 joins group.
+ * 2. c1 gets assigned 2 partitions.
+ * - there isn't a follow-on rebalance because there aren't any revoked
+ * partitions.
+ * 3. c2 joins group.
+ * 4. This results in a rebalance with one partition being revoked from c1,
+ * and no partitions assigned to either c1 or c2 (however the rebalance
+ * callback will be called in each case with an empty set).
+ * 5. c1 then re-joins the group since it had a partition revoked.
+ * 6. c2 is now assigned a single partition, and c1's incremental assignment
+ * is empty.
+ * 7. Since there were no revoked partitions, no further rebalance is
+ * triggered.
+ */
+
+ /* The rebalance cb is always called on assign, even if empty. */
+ if (rebalance_cb1.assign_call_cnt != 3)
+ Test::Fail(tostr() << "Expecting 3 assign calls on consumer 1, not "
+ << rebalance_cb1.assign_call_cnt);
+ if (rebalance_cb2.assign_call_cnt != 2)
+ Test::Fail(tostr() << "Expecting 2 assign calls on consumer 2,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b2.assign_call_cnt);
+
+ /* The rebalance cb is not called on and empty revoke (unless partitions lost,
+ * which is not the case here) */
+ if (rebalance_cb1.revoke_call_cnt != 1)
+ Test::Fail(tostr() << "Expecting 1 revoke call on consumer 1,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b1.revoke_call_cnt);
+ if (rebalance_cb2.revoke_call_cnt != 0)
+ Test::Fail(tostr() << "Expecting 0 revoke calls on consumer 2,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b2.revoke_call_cnt);
+
+ /* Final state */
+
+ /* Expect both consumers to have 1 assigned partition (via net calculation in
+ * rebalance_cb) */
+ if (rebalance_cb1.partitions_assigned_net != 1)
+ Test::Fail(tostr()
+ << "Expecting consumer 1 to have net 1 assigned partition,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b1.partitions_assigned_net);
+ if (rebalance_cb2.partitions_assigned_net != 1)
+ Test::Fail(tostr()
+ << "Expecting consumer 2 to have net 1 assigned partition,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b2.partitions_assigned_net);
+
+ /* Expect both consumers to have 1 assigned partition (via ->assignment()
+ * query) */
+ expect_assignment(c1, 1);
+ expect_assignment(c2, 1);
+
+ /* Make sure the fetchers are running */
+ int msgcnt = 100;
+ const int msgsize1 = 100;
+ test_produce_msgs_easy_size(topic_name.c_str(), 0, 0, msgcnt, msgsize1);
+ test_produce_msgs_easy_size(topic_name.c_str(), 0, 1, msgcnt, msgsize1);
+
+ bool consumed_from_c1 = false;
+ bool consumed_from_c2 = false;
+ while (true) {
+ RdKafka::Message *msg1 = c1->consume(100);
+ RdKafka::Message *msg2 = c2->consume(100);
+
+ if (msg1->err() == RdKafka::ERR_NO_ERROR)
+ consumed_from_c1 = true;
+ if (msg1->err() == RdKafka::ERR_NO_ERROR)
+ consumed_from_c2 = true;
+
+ delete msg1;
+ delete msg2;
+
+ /* Failure case: test will timeout. */
+ if (consumed_from_c1 && consumed_from_c2)
+ break;
+ }
+
+ if (!close_consumer) {
+ delete c1;
+ delete c2;
+ return;
+ }
+
+ c1->close();
+ c2->close();
+
+ /* Closing the consumer should trigger rebalance_cb (revoke): */
+ if (rebalance_cb1.revoke_call_cnt != 2)
+ Test::Fail(tostr() << "Expecting 2 revoke calls on consumer 1,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b1.revoke_call_cnt);
+ if (rebalance_cb2.revoke_call_cnt != 1)
+ Test::Fail(tostr() << "Expecting 1 revoke call on consumer 2,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b2.revoke_call_cnt);
+
+ /* ..and net assigned partitions should drop to 0 in both cases: */
+ if (rebalance_cb1.partitions_assigned_net != 0)
+ Test::Fail(
+ tostr()
+ << "Expecting consumer 1 to have net 0 assigned partitions,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b1.partitions_assigned_net);
+ if (rebalance_cb2.partitions_assigned_net != 0)
+ Test::Fail(
+ tostr()
+ << "Expecting consumer 2 to have net 0 assigned partitions,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b2.partitions_assigned_net);
+
+ /* Nothing in this test should result in lost partitions */
+ if (rebalance_cb1.lost_call_cnt > 0)
+ Test::Fail(
+ tostr() << "Expecting consumer 1 to have 0 lost partition events,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b1.lost_call_cnt);
+ if (rebalance_cb2.lost_call_cnt > 0)
+ Test::Fail(
+ tostr() << "Expecting consumer 2 to have 0 lost partition events, not: "
+ << rebalance_cb2.lost_call_cnt);
+
+ delete c1;
+ delete c2;
+
+ SUB_TEST_PASS();
+}
